Visiting our ER

When you arrive at the emergency room, you will be quickly assessed by a triage nurse who will assess the severity of your condition and prioritize your care accordingly. You may also be asked to provide information about your medical history and any medications you are currently taking.

Once you are admitted to the emergency room, you will be evaluated by a physician who will order any necessary tests or imaging studies to help diagnose your condition. Treatment will be tailored to your specific needs, and may include medication, surgery, or other interventions.

Emergency care at Methodist Healthcare

Emergency care is the treatment of emergent medical conditions. It is generally performed in an emergency room, but can also refer to treatment in an ambulance. Emergency medicine physicians may treat patients with injuries or infections, in addition to life-threatening conditions.
